Common Wood Handrail Repair Jobs
Wood handrail repair restores stability and safety to damaged or loose handrails.
Cracked or splintered wood repairs address surface damage for a smooth, safe finish.
Rot or water damage restoration prevents further deterioration and extends handrail lifespan.
Refinishing and sanding improve appearance and prepare wood for protective finishes.
Custom fitting ensures handrails are securely reinstalled to match existing staircases.
Minor repairs fix loose joints or fittings to prevent wobbling and ensure safety.
Wood Handrail Repair Questions
What types of damage can wood handrails be repaired for? Damage such as cracks, splinters, loose fittings, and surface wear can typically be repaired to restore safety and appearance.
Are repairs suitable for all wood handrail styles? Repairs can be performed on most wood handrail styles, including traditional, modern, and custom designs.
What are common reasons for needing handrail repairs? Common reasons include age-related wear, accidental impacts, or ongoing exposure to moisture and temperature changes.
Will repairs match the existing wood finish? Repairs can be finished to match the existing stain and paint, helping the handrail blend seamlessly with the surrounding decor.
